Which of the following is an example of mismatched blood transfusion?

  1. Type 1 hypersensitivity

  2. Type 2 hypersensitivity

  3. Type 3 hypersensitivity

  4. Type 4 hypersensitivity

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
B Correct answer
Explanation

Type 2 hypersensitivities involve interactions of surface antigens of cells followed by complement assisted lysis of cells. Mismatched blood transfusion is an example of type 2 hypersensitivity. On the basis of antigens on the cell surface, there are 4 blood groups and incompatibility exists if the blood containing different Ag is given.
